The spectacular Olympic Games, held in Athens in 2004, triggered numerous cultural, architectural and infrastructure renovations that attract some 30 million visitors annually from around the world. Athens, being a touristic paradise, has many museums to enjoy, like the New Acropolis Museum, the Numismatic Museum (with one of the richest collections of coins evidencing the history of currencies as from the 7th century BC until today), the Byzantine and Christian Museum, the National Museum of Modern Art, the unique Epigraphic Museum hosting over 14.000 inscriptions, just to name a few. The must-see modern New Acropolis Museum offers breath-taking views of classical sculptures, including the famous Caryatides, the sign of feminine elegance that inspired this year’s Conference pro le. For relaxing strolls, Plaka, Thisio and Monastiraki forming the historic city centre at the foot of Acropolis, are the ideal places to get a flavour of Athens combined with shopping.
